A GameCube ISO (often referred to as a ROM) is a digital copy of the data stored on the original 8cm GameCube optical discs.

Standard Size: Almost all GameCube ISOs are exactly 1.35 GB, regardless of the game's actual content size, because they are full-disc images.

Spanish (Español) Versions: To play in Spanish, you must specifically seek out PAL (European) or Multi5 (Spanish, English, French, German, Italian) ISOs. Many North American (NTSC-U) versions only include English and sometimes French or Spanish.

Region Locking: Original hardware is region-locked (NTSC-U for Americas, PAL for Europe). However, emulators and modded consoles can bypass these restrictions to play Spanish PAL ISOs on NTSC hardware. 2. Top GameCube Titles with Spanish Support

To play these ISOs today, several modern solutions are available: Description Dolphin Emulator

The gold standard for GameCube/Wii emulation. It runs on Windows, macOS, Linux, and Android. It supports HD upscaling and wide-screen hacks. Mobile Emulation

Platforms like Dyllie allow GameCube emulation on iOS devices, while Android users can use the mobile version of Dolphin Emulator. Native Hardware

Modded consoles can run ISOs via an SD Media Launcher or GC Loader. For Japanese consoles, a hardware mod (resistor change) can even switch the system language to English to facilitate navigation. 4. Technical Specifications
